Shredding Techniques for Perfect Chicken Tacos

Shredding rotisserie chicken is easy with the right methods. Follow these steps for tender, shredded meat:

  • Wait for the chicken to cool slightly, but remain warm
  • Use two forks to pull the meat apart
  • Alternately, wear clean kitchen gloves and shred by hand
  • Remove skin and separate white and dark meat as desired

Low-Carb Lettuce Wrap Options

Want a lighter option than regular tortillas? Lettuce wraps are great for chicken tacos with rotisserie chicken. They make healthy chicken tacos a tasty and light meal.

When picking lettuce for wraps, two types are best:

  • Iceberg lettuce: It’s crisp and sturdy, adding a nice crunch
  • Butter lettuce: Its soft leaves wrap well around fillings

To avoid soggy wraps, pat lettuce leaves dry with a towel. This keeps the wrap firm and prevents moisture.

Homemade Gluten-Free Tortilla Alternatives

Making your own gluten-free tortillas lets you choose what goes into them. A simple corn tortilla recipe needs just a few things:

  1. Masa harina (corn flour)
  2. Warm water
  3. Pinch of salt
  4. Optional: Small amount of oil

Making the Perfect Avocado Salsa

Take your simple chicken taco meal to the next level with a fresh avocado salsa. This creamy, zesty condiment turns ordinary tacos into a delightful experience.

Making the perfect avocado salsa needs fresh ingredients and attention to detail. You want a salsa that complements the rich flavors of rotisserie chicken. It should also add a bright, creamy touch to your tacos.

Selecting Premium Ingredients

  • Choose ripe Hass avocados with a slight give when gently squeezed
  • Select fresh cilantro with vibrant green leaves
  • Pick firm, juicy limes for maximum citrus punch
  • Use red onions for a mild, sweet crunch

Preparation Techniques

To keep your avocado salsa fresh and prevent browning, follow these steps:

  1. Dice avocados immediately before serving
  2. Add lime juice to slow oxidation
  3. Chop ingredients uniformly for balanced texture
  4. Mix gently to preserve avocado chunks

Meal Prep and Storage Solutions

Preparing a tasty chicken taco dinner is easy. Smart meal prep turns your tacos into a quick, healthy option for weeknights. With the right storage, you can enjoy fresh tacos all week.

Storing your taco ingredients right is key. Shred the rotisserie chicken and store it in airtight containers. This keeps it fresh for quick meals. Your taco parts will stay tasty for 3-5 days in the fridge.

Meal Prep Storage Tips

  • Shred rotisserie chicken and store in sealed containers
  • Chop fresh vegetables separately to maintain crispness
  • Keep salsa and sauces in glass containers with tight lids
  • Separate wet and dry ingredients to prevent sogginess

For the best chicken taco dinner, try these meal prep tips:

Ingredient Storage Method Shelf Life
Shredded Chicken Airtight container 3-4 days
Chopped Vegetables Sealed plastic container 2-3 days
Salsa Glass jar with lid 5-7 days

Pro tip: Label your containers with dates to track freshness and reduce food waste. Reheat your chicken easily. Use a microwave or skillet on medium heat, adding broth to keep it moist.

FAQ

How long can I store shredded rotisserie chicken for tacos?

You can keep shredded rotisserie chicken in the fridge for 3-4 days. Make sure it’s cooled down first. This keeps it safe to eat.

Can I freeze rotisserie chicken for future taco meals?

Yes, you can freeze it for up to 3 months. Use freezer-safe containers or bags. Remove air to avoid freezer burn. Thaw it in the fridge before using.

What are the best lettuce options for low-carb taco wraps?

Iceberg, butter lettuce, and romaine are great. They’re crisp and can hold fillings well.

How can I make my rotisserie chicken tacos spicier?

Add fresh jalapeños or cayenne pepper to your mix. Use hot sauce or spicy salsa. Chipotle powder or crushed red pepper flakes also work.

Are rotisserie chicken tacos a healthy meal option?

They can be if you choose wisely. Use lean chicken and lots of veggies. Pick whole grain or low-carb tortillas and watch your toppings.

What gluten-free tortilla alternatives can I use?

Try corn, almond flour, cassava flour tortillas, or lettuce wraps. You can also find chickpea or coconut flour tortillas.

How can I prevent my lettuce wraps from getting soggy?

Pat dry your ingredients before assembling. Add wet toppings just before eating. Use cheese or guacamole as a barrier.

What’s the best way to shred rotisserie chicken quickly?

Use two forks or a stand mixer with a paddle. Let it cool slightly and then use your hands for faster shredding.

Can I make these tacos ahead of time for meal prep?

Prep the chicken, veggies, and salsa ahead. Store them in the fridge. Assemble just before eating for the best taste and texture.

What are some healthy toppings for rotisserie chicken tacos?

Choose fresh cilantro, diced tomatoes, red onions, and sliced jalapeños. Lime juice, Greek yogurt, and a bit of avocado or guacamole are also good.
